Understanding Adjustment of Status and Its Complexities

Adjustment of Status is the method by which a person shifts their immigration standing from a temporary or undocumented classification to that of a lawful permanent resident. It appears like a single step, but it in reality involves numerous forms, supplementary documents, medical examinations, background investigations, and frequently an in-person interview. Each of these phases has its own array of guidelines, and neglecting even a tiny element can lead to delays or complete refusals.

How an Attorney Helps You Avoid Costly Mistakes

Among the greatest reasons to engage an attorney is the enormous number of paperwork required. Form I-485, the primary form for Adjustment of Status, is merely the starting point. Depending on your circumstances, you may likewise have to complete and submit Form I-130, Form I-864, employment authorization paperwork, and travel authorization documents — each of which comes with precise directions and supporting documentation requirements. An skilled attorney recognizes precisely which applications apply to your individual case and how to fill them out without errors the very first time.

Mistakes on immigration applications are not small problems. A erroneous answer, a absent sign-off, or an unfinished section can lead to a Request for Evidence from USCIS, which contributes significant delays to your wait time. In graver scenarios, discrepancies or inaccuracies may spark alarm that lead to more extensive investigation or even assumptions of fraud. An legal representative goes over every aspect before submittal, significantly reducing the risk of these problems.

Beyond paperwork, attorneys understand the legal nuances that most applicants just aren’t conscious of. For example, certain prior immigration offenses, criminal records, or prior deportation orders can establish bars to eligibility that aren’t necessarily clear. A experienced lawyer can assess your history honestly and help you recognize whether a waiver is obtainable or if an different strategy would more effectively advance your interests.
